Transaction 660c68bab5a721ef14d36a60236ec10b01e380514759c1e4d505629893ba4b63
1 Input
1 Output
-
660c68bab5a721ef14d36a60236ec10b01e380514759c1e4d505629893ba4b63:0
- value
- 246252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d0e41c924289d388e923f580cb83379cf6a179e OP_EQUAL
- address
- 3MqrLXiAbVawgUEwK6rLVDMm3o7qv71yhy